
Chih-Wei Hu and Jake Reed join Kernels from Elizabethton
Published on July 7, 2014 under Midwest League (MWL1)
Cedar Rapids Kernels News Release
Cedar Rapids, IA - The Cedar Rapids Kernels and Minnesota Twins announce that RHP Chih-Wei Hu and RHP Jake Reed will join the Kernels from Elizabethton (APPY) and that RHP Ethan Mildren and RHP Todd Van Steensel have been promoted to Fort Myers (FSL). Brad Steil, Director of Minor League Operations for the Twins, announced the move.
The Twins selected Reed in the fifth round of the 2014 First Year Player Draft out of the University of Oregon. In four relief appearances at Elizabethton, he has no record and three saves in 6 IP, allowing one hit and striking out eight. In 31 relief appearances at Oregon this year, he posted a 4-1 record, 1.95 ERA and 13 saves, allowing 22 hits and nine runs (eight earned) with 15 walks and 34 strikeouts in 37 IP.
The Twins signed Hu as a non-drafted free agent on August 3, 2012. He spent last season with the GCL Twins, posting a 2-0 record and 2.45 ERA in 12 games (five starts). In 36.2 IP, he allowed 28 hits and 11 runs (10 earned) with eight walks and 39 strikeouts. In three starts this season at Elizabethton, he has a 1-0 record and 1.69 ERA, allowing seven hits and three runs (all earned) with two walks and 16 strikeouts in 16 IP.
Mildren appeared in 14 games (13 starts) for the Kernels, posting a 3-5 record and 4.03 ERA. In 73.2 IP, he allowed 78 hits and 35 runs (33 earned) with 16 walks and 54 strikeouts.
Van Steensel made 23 relief appearances for the Kernels, posting a 1.30 ERA, no record and eight saves in nine chances. In 34.2 IP, he allowed 23 hits and five runs (all earned) with nine walks and 45 strikeouts.
With today's transactions, the Kernels roster is at the Midwest League maximum of 25 active players, with seven players currently on the DL.
